Carb Blockers: Fact or Fiction for Dropping Those Last Few Pounds?
Are you struggling to shed those last few pounds, despite your best efforts at diet and exercise? The allure of a quick fix can be strong, leading many to turn to carb blockers, supplements that guarantee to inhibit the absorption of carbohydrates. But do these pills actually work, or are they just another fad diet trend destined for the trash heap? The scientific evidence on carb blockers is mixed, with some studies showing modest weight loss effects while others find no significant difference compared to a placebo.
- Health professionals caution that carb blockers should not be viewed as a magic bullet for weight loss.
- Long-term consequences of using carb blockers are still unknown.
- It's crucial to consult with your doctor before trying any new supplement, including carb blockers.
While carb blockers may offer a temporary solution for reducing carbohydrate intake, they should not replace a healthy approach that focuses on balanced meals, regular exercise, and overall well-being.
Fat vs. Carbs: Which Fuel Burns Faster and Better?
When it comes to fueling your body, carbs are often the center of attention. But which one truly burns faster? The truth isn't always so obvious. Both fat and carbs deliver energy, but they do so in unique ways. Fat is a denser source of calories, meaning it packs more energy per gram, while carbs are rapidly digested by the body for an fast burst of energy. Ultimately, the best fuel for you depends on your goals.
- Think about your activity level: High-intensity workouts might benefit from quick-burning carbs, while endurance activities may demand sustained energy from fat.
- Be aware of your overall diet: A balanced approach that features both fats and carbs is typically the healthiest choice.
- Pay attention to your body: Experiment with numerous food sources to see what fuels you best.
